Book excerpt: If English is sounding like a foreign language, make it easy and effortless with the ultimate study guide. This visual reference book takes you through all the different parts of the English language, leaving you ready to help your children tackle the trickiest of subjects. DK's unique study aid encourages parents and children to work together as a team to understand and use all aspects of the English language, including grammar, punctuation, and spelling. This latest title in the best-selling Help Your Kids series… combines pictures, diagrams, instructions, and examples to cover the components of the school syllabus, while building knowledge, boosting confidence, and aiding understanding. With your support, children can overcome the challenges of English, leaving them calm, confident, and exam ready. Series Overview: DK's bestselling Help Your Kids With series contains crystal-clear visual breakdowns of important subjects. Simple graphics and jargon-free text are key to making this series a user-friendly resource for frustrated parents who want to help their children get the most out of school.

Book excerpt: My First Words is a fun resource for teaching your child their first words in English. Each word in the book is illustrated to help your little one associate it with its meaning, to help them remember it, and to make the learning process interesting and fun. The book contains over 80 words, which are organised into themes, including animals, fruit and vegetables, clothes and colours. These basic yet important words will form an invaluable foundation upon which your child will be able to build as they continue to learn English later in life. Children who learn languages through play at an early age are more likely to succeed in foreign language learning as adults. And that's exactly what My First Words aims to help parents with - enthusing their kids, showing them the exciting world of another language and culture, and opening up a world of opportunities that foreign language education brings. Agnieszka Murdoch, the author of the book and educator with more than 15 years of experience of learning and teaching foreign languages, created My First Words with her own daughter in mind. She needed a resource that would help her introduce her daughter to her first foreign words and to help her embark on the exciting lifelong journey that learning foreign languages brings.
